Have you tried booting in safe mode?

To have your computer pause at the blue screen: When your computer enters the BIOS, press the F8 key (might have to hit it repeatedly, just to be safe) then go down the list to where it says "Disable Automatic Restart on System Failure." When the blue screen comes up the next time it won't reboot automatically and you should be able to write down the code on the screen.

I know the post is older, but for anyone searching for a solution:

i had the same prob, easily fixed as follows:

Booted with Ubuntu Live CD,
navigated to Windows/System32/drivers,
delete fbfmon.sys


(Win7, 64, Lenovo G770)
